The DJI Air 3S is the camera drone I keep reaching for when image quality matters more than portability. After flying it for several weeks across different locations, the dual-camera system became the standout feature. The 1-inch CMOS wide-angle camera captures detail and dynamic range that the Mini series simply cannot match, especially in challenging light conditions.

What surprised me most was how the medium tele camera at 70mm equivalent changed my aerial composition. It lets you compress backgrounds, isolate subjects from the landscape, and capture perspectives that feel closer to traditional telephoto street photography. This combination of two focal lengths in one drone is genuinely useful for creative work.

Camera Quality and Dual-Sensor Versatility

The 1-inch CMOS sensor on the wide-angle camera produces 48MP stills and 4K/60fps HDR video with up to 14 stops of dynamic range. In my testing, footage retained clean shadow detail and controlled highlights even when shooting directly into low sun angles. The 10-bit D-Log M and HLG color modes give you serious grading flexibility in post-production.

The medium tele camera delivers a 70mm equivalent focal length that opens up creative options most drones cannot offer. You can frame tighter shots of architectural details, compress landscapes for a more cinematic feel, and shoot portraits from the air with a natural-looking perspective. For street photographers used to 50mm or 85mm lenses, this tele camera feels familiar.

Flight Time, Range, and Transmission Performance

DJI rates the Air 3S at 45 minutes of flight time per battery, and I consistently got 38 to 41 minutes of real-world flying before the 20 percent battery warning. With three batteries in the Fly More Combo, that translates to roughly two hours of total air time per session. The O4 transmission system maintained a rock-solid connection at distances up to 15km in my testing before I turned back.

DJI Air 3S Fly More Combo (RC 2 Screen Remote Controller), Drone with 1

Omnidirectional Obstacle Sensing with LiDAR

The forward-facing LiDAR sensor is a genuine advancement. It enables reliable obstacle sensing even in low-light conditions where traditional vision sensors struggle. I tested night flights in urban environments with streetlights and mixed shadows, and the Air 3S detected obstacles that would have caused trouble with older sensing systems.

The Next-Gen Smart Return-to-Home function impressed me in areas with weak GPS signals. Instead of relying solely on GPS coordinates, it builds a visual map during outbound flight and uses that to navigate back safely. This matters in urban canyons, forests, and other GPS-challenged environments where photographers often work.

Who Should Buy the DJI Air 3S

This is the ideal drone for serious photographers and content creators who want professional image quality without stepping up to the Mavic 4 Pro’s price territory. If you shoot travel photography, real estate, or commercial work and need reliable dual-camera versatility, the Air 3S hits a sweet spot between capability and practicality.

Beginners with larger budgets will also find it approachable thanks to the intuitive DJI Fly app and automated flight modes. Just be aware that at 724 grams, you will need FAA registration and Remote ID compliance to fly legally in the United States.

How to Choose the Best Camera Drone for Your Needs

Choosing the right camera drone comes down to matching technical capabilities with your specific photography goals. After testing all 8 drones in this guide, I can tell you that the best drone is not the one with the most impressive spec sheet. It is the one that fits how you actually shoot, where you fly, and what you do with your footage.

Camera Sensor Size and Image Quality

Sensor size is the single most important factor for image quality, just as it is in traditional photography. The DJI Mavic 4 Pro’s 4/3 Hasselblad sensor produces dramatically better images than the 1/2.3-inch sensor in the Mini 4K. If you plan to crop, print large, or shoot in challenging light, invest in the largest sensor you can afford.

The 1-inch sensor in the Air 3S and Mini 5 Pro represents the sweet spot for most photographers. It delivers professional-grade quality without the premium price of the Mavic 4 Pro. If you are upgrading from a smaller sensor, the improvement in dynamic range and low-light performance will be immediately obvious.

Sub-250g Weight and FAA Registration

In the United States, drones weighing under 250 grams do not require FAA registration. This is a significant practical advantage that affects where and how you can fly. The DJI Mini 4K, Mini 3, Mini 5 Pro, Potensic Atom 2, and DJI Neo all qualify for this exemption.

Drones over 250g, including the Air 3S, Mavic 4 Pro, and Ruko F11PRO 2, require FAA registration. If you fly commercially, you also need a Part 107 certification regardless of drone weight. International regulations vary, so check local laws before traveling with any drone.

Flight Time and Battery Strategy

Advertised flight times rarely match real-world performance. In my testing across all 8 drones, actual flight times ran 10 to 15 percent shorter than manufacturer claims once you account for takeoff, landing, wind resistance, and safety margins. Plan your sessions around realistic expectations.

The Fly More Combo packages from DJI include multiple batteries, which is the practical solution. The Air 3S with three batteries gives you roughly two hours of total shooting time. The Potensic Atom 2’s three-battery setup delivers 96 minutes. Always factor battery cost into your total budget.

Obstacle Avoidance and Flight Safety

Obstacle avoidance technology has improved dramatically. The Air 3S and Mini 5 Pro both use LiDAR-based omnidirectional sensing that works in low light. The Mavic 4 Pro’s 0.1-Lux Nightscape system operates in near-darkness. These systems significantly reduce crash risk, especially for expensive drones.

Older or budget drones like the Mini 3 and Ruko F11PRO 2 have limited or basic obstacle sensing. If you are a beginner or fly in complex environments like forests or urban areas, prioritize models with comprehensive obstacle avoidance. The cost of a replacement drone far exceeds the price difference.

Transmission Range and Controller Quality

Transmission range matters less than you might think for photography, since FAA rules require visual line of sight in most cases. However, signal stability at moderate distances is important for confidence. DJI’s O4 and O4+ systems are the current gold standard, maintaining stable connections at distances up to 20 to 30km.

Controller quality significantly affects the flying experience. The DJI RC 2 with its built-in screen eliminates smartphone mounting issues and glare problems. The Potensic Atom 2’s 5.5-inch touchscreen controller is similarly excellent. Avoid drones that rely solely on smartphone screens if possible, especially for outdoor use.

RAW Photo Workflow for Aerial Photography

Several drones on this list support RAW photo capture, which is essential for professional editing workflows. The DJI Mini 3 explicitly lists RAW as a supported image format, and higher-end DJI models offer RAW as well. RAW files preserve maximum dynamic range and give you far more flexibility when adjusting exposure, white balance, and color in post-production.

For street photographers transitioning to aerial work, the RAW workflow is familiar territory. Shoot in RAW, import into Lightroom or Capture One, and apply your existing editing techniques. The main difference is that aerial RAW files often need more attention to horizon leveling and distortion correction due to the gimbal’s wide-angle lens.

Why did DJI drones get banned?

DJI drones have faced restrictions in certain contexts due to US national security concerns. The Department of Defense and some federal agencies have limited DJI drone use on government property. However, DJI drones remain legal for civilian and commercial use in the United States. Individual states and local jurisdictions may have additional restrictions. Always check current regulations in your area before purchasing.
